The resonator shouldn't make any differance at at for emmissions. In fact it does nothing to curb emmissions. It's purpose is to act as a primary muffler before the actual muffler. Its purpose it to help reduce noise.

I would recommend keeping the resonator anyway as the drone gets way to loud and will give you a headache after time.. or you have to keep the radio up too loud to drown it out but can't have a decent conversation in the car.
